Shehbaz girds up his loins to give tough time to govt

PML-N President and Opposition leader in National Assembly Shehbaz Sharif has become active to give tough time to the government by expediting his contacts with the opposition leaders and members to fizzle out the government plan to railroad legislation from parliament on majority basis, reported 24NewsHD TV channel.

Sources revealed on Tuesday that the PML-N president spurred his efforts to frustrate government plan to bulldoze bills from parliament on majority basis. He is making contacts with the opposition leaders and has formed two parliamentary committees of the opposition in this regard, sources added.

According to sources, the separate meetings of both the committees regarding to devising protest strategy and a constitutional way to halt the government process of legislation would be held consecutively. 

Opposition leader Shehbaz will hold a dinner tonight in honour of opposition parties’ members in the national and provincial assemblies at the Banquet Hall of Parliament House. Both the committees will come into action even before the dinner. 

PPP Chairman Bilawal Bhutto Zardari, Asad Mehmood, Amir Haider Hoti and other parliamentary leaders of the opposition parties would participate in the dinner. 

The opposition leaders will deliberate on a joint strategy to impede government legislation process in both the upper and lower houses. 

The protest committee will point to the quorum in the parliament and chalk out a protest strategy. 

Whereas, the opposition’s legislation committee comprising legal experts will review the bills presented by the government. It will suggest strategy to challenge the bills in courts. It will also review government bills including electoral reforms, voting right to overseas Pakistanis, amendments to National Accountability Ordinances and other laws.
